Omar Samhan Is A Confident Young Man

Omar Samhan, Ali Farokhmanesh: Two names that likely meant nothing to you five days ago, but are now as familiar as Scottie Reynolds and Sherron Collins. And while Farokhmanesh seems more reserved, content to let dagger three-pointers do the talking for him, Samhan has displayed a more ... colorful personality.

↵For example, after St. Mary’s upset No. 2 Villanova on Saturday, Samhan openly critized coach Jay Wright for not double-teaming him:

↵↵“I get it,” he said. “I’m a slow white guy, and I’m overweight. So maybe you don’t respect me because I have good numbers. But after I kill you the first half, what are you waiting for. I don’t know what he wanted. Did he want me to have 40?”

↵↵Samhan was dominant in that game, scoring 32 points, but let’s knock him down a few notches here: double-team or not, Nova probably wins that game if Reynolds is even close to his normal self on offense. He had eight points on 2-11 shooting. Of course, Scottie was ice cold from the field for the entire month of March, while Samhan has decided to peak just in time for the Madness.

↵Oh, and his YouTube handle is poopshower. Colorful, indeed.
